Billie Lea Sweeten of Rock Island, Oklahoma was born March 27, 1941 in Fort Smith, Arkansas to W.J. and Lillian (Fern) Jones, and passed away June 25, 2021 in Fort Smith, Arkansas at the age of 80.

 

She is survived by her daughters, Glenda James, Sherry James and husband Gene; sons, Randy Sweeten and wife Bonnie, Shawn Sweeten and wife Tamara; grandchildren, Austin Miller, Kaelee Brown, Shelby James, Tanner James, Shawna Sweeten, Blake Sweeten, Maddox Sweeten Teagan Macon; great grandchildren, Mason Fox, Hunter Miller, Hayven Miller, Luxy Sweeten, Lela Brown, Grant Henry, Coen Wofford; bonus grandchildren, Whitley Christmas, Tanner Barnes, Jacob Barnes; sisters, Agnes Knapp, Linda Paz numerous nieces, nephews, other relatives, and loved ones.

 

Billie was preceded in death by her parents, W.J. and Lillian Jones; husband, Roy Sweeten; grandson, Brandon Sweeten; son-in-law, Paul James; three brothers and three sisters. She loved spending time with her family especially her grandchildren and great grandchildren. They were her world! Billie owned and operated County Café in Cameron, she was known for her coconut crème pies and chicken fried steak.
